MDPI in Manchester is seeking an entry-level Assistant Editor to support editorial workflows for academic journals.

You will coordinate peer-review, manage communications with authors and reviewers, and collaborate with editorial and production teams to ensure timely publication.

The role emphasizes accuracy, deadlines, and international teamwork, with a focus on developing editorial skills in a dynamic publishing environment.

Some tips for your application 🫡

Get Creative with Your CV:In the publishing and media world, your CV should not just list your experiences; it should showcase your creativity! Use a clean layout and consider integrating elements that highlight your passion for storytelling or design. Make sure to include any relevant coursework or projects that demonstrate your writing or editing skills.

Showcase Your Writing Skills:For an entry-level role in publishing, including a portfolio of your writing samples is key. Whether it's articles, short stories, or blog posts, these samples should reflect your style and versatility. If you have experience with editing or content creation, throw that in too – it shows you're not just a writer but also understand the process behind crafting great stories.

Craft a Tailored Cover Letter:This is your chance to let your passion for publishing shine! In your cover letter, tell us why you're excited about this specific entry-level position at MDPI Romania. Share what you've learned in your studies or experiences that relate directly to the role, and sprinkle in some insights about the industry trends you find compelling.

Include Relevant Experience:Even if you don't have tonnes of formal work experience, think outside the box! Internships, volunteer roles, or even personal projects can demonstrate your dedication and understanding of the publishing field. Don't forget to highlight specific skills such as content management systems or an eye for detail—qualities that we value here at MDPI Romania!

How to prepare for a job interview at MDPI Romania

Show Us Your Creative Flair

Prepare to showcase your writing or design samples! Whether it's articles, blog posts, or graphic designs, having a portfolio that highlights your style and creativity is essential in the publishing-media field. Make sure to pick pieces that resonate with the type of work MDPI Romania does!

Know Your Tools

Familiarise yourself with industry-standard tools and software, like Adobe Creative Suite or content management systems if you're leaning towards digital publishing. Being able to discuss how you’ve used these tools or your willingness to learn them can really make you stand out in an entry-level interview.

Brush Up on Recent Trends

Keep an eye on current trends in publishing and media—this could be anything from the rise of audiobooks to changes in magazine formats. Showing that you're clued up on hot topics will impress your interviewers and demonstrate your enthusiasm for the field.

Emphasise Your Learning Mindset

As this is an entry-level position, employers at MDPI Romania will be keen on your eagerness to learn and grow. Be prepared to discuss what you hope to gain from the role and how you can contribute as a fresh perspective in the team. Enthusiasm and a willingness to develop are key here!
